The Automobile Museum Málaga is a museum that showcases a private collection of more than 100 vintage and classic cars, as well as over 200 haute couture pieces and accessories from different periods and styles. The museum is located in the old Royal Tobacco Factory, a historical building from the 1920s that has been restored and adapted to host this cultural project. The museum aims to offer a comprehensive and educational view of the history, design, technology and glamour of cars and fashion.

A Thematic and Chronological Exhibition

The Automobile museum Malaga is divided into 13 thematic areas that correspond to different eras and trends in the history of cars and fashion. Each area displays a selection of cars from prestigious brands such as Bugatti, Rolls-Royce, Bentley, Jaguar, Ferrari, Mercedes-Benz and others. The cars are exhibited in their original condition or restored with original parts. Some of the cars have been customized by famous artists such as Sonia Delaunay, Andy Warhol or Salvador Dalí.

Along with the cars, each area also displays a selection of fashion items that match the style and spirit of each period. The fashion items include dresses, hats, shoes, bags and jewellery from renowned designers such as Chanel, Dior, Balenciaga, Schiaparelli, Yves Saint Laurent and others. The fashion items are exhibited in mannequins or showcases that recreate the atmosphere and context of each era.

The museum also offers a glimpse into the social and cultural aspects of each era, such as the role of women, the influence of cinema and music, the environmental challenges and the technological innovations. The museum provides information panels, multimedia displays, interactive games and audiovisual projections that complement the exhibition. The museum also provides audio guides in different languages that explain the history and stories behind each car and each fashion piece, as well as their creators and owners.

Explore The Automobile Museum of Malaga

  • Belle Epoque: This area shows the cars and fashion from the late 19th century to the early 20th century, a period of optimism, prosperity and innovation. You can see cars such as a 1898 Hurtu Quadricycle or a 1906 Renault Frères Taxi de la Marne. You can also see fashion items such as a 1900 Worth ball gown or a 1910 Poiret turban.
  • Art Deco: This area shows the cars and fashion from the 1920s and 1930s, a period of elegance, glamour and modernity. You can see cars such as a 1925 Hispano Suiza H6B or a 1931 Rolls-Royce Phantom II Sedanca de Ville. You can also see fashion items such as a 1925 Chanel little black dress or a 1930 Schiaparelli lobster dress.
  • Dolce Vita: This area shows the cars and fashion from the 1950s and 1960s, a period of prosperity, leisure and hedonism. You can see cars such as a 1956 Cadillac Eldorado Biarritz or a 1966 Jaguar E-Type. You can also see fashion items such as a 1955 Dior new look dress or a 1967 Courrèges space age suit.
  • Dream Cars: This area shows the cars that represent the dreams and fantasies of their owners and creators. You will be able to see cars such as a 1953 Cadillac Series 62 Coupé by Ghia or a 2010 Bugatti Veyron Grand Sport. Another great thing is to see cars that have been customized by famous artists such as Sonia Delaunay, Andy Warhol or Salvador Dalí.
  • English Tradition: This area shows the cars and fashion that reflect the elegance, refinement and tradition of the British style, such as a 1937 Bentley Derby Drophead Coupé or a 1964 Aston Martin DB5. Also on display are fashion items such as a 1947 Hardy Amies suit or a 1966 Mary Quant miniskirt.

A Place for All Audiences

The Automobile and Fashion Museum is open from Monday to Sunday from 10:00 to 19:00. The entrance fee is 9.50 euros for adults and 4 euros for children and seniors. The museum also offers a combined ticket that includes access to other museums in Málaga, such as the Russian Museum or the Pompidou Centre. The museum’s website provides more information on the prices, discounts and promotions.

The museum also organizes guided tours, workshops, lectures and other events for all audiences. The museum offers educational programs for schools and groups that cover different topics related to cars and fashion, such as mechanics, restoration, photography or modelling. The museum also offers cultural activities for families, adults and seniors that aim to stimulate curiosity, creativity and learning.
